Here's a few potted highlights from an excellent weekend in 
Lancaster.

There were 12 teams in 3 pools and the top two from each pool played 
the other top two teams from the other pools (with the result from 
your pool against the other team going through being carried forward) 
which gave us the top 8 for quarters, semis and finals. Confused? we 
certainly were, but it all worked out nicely in the end.

Sunday saw several upsets-we got dumped by Bradford (though they'd 
had an early night) and Catch (who'd looked like they were just there 
to show everyone how many scubas and no-look throws it's possible to 
have in a single indoor game) got pipped by St. Andrews.

Sneeeky's I lost their semi to St. Andrews (well done on finally doing it-it's 
about bloody time!) and Catch beat Bradford. The final was a very 
rowdy affair with Sneeeky's I and II and Glasgow making one hell of a 
din for the Scots and likewise Jedi for Catch. Catch finally 
triumphed, but only after bringing on "The Gaffer".

All in all an absolutely topping weekend and Sneeeky's I winning the 
Spirit was just the icing on the cake.
